Ok, after months and months of research and listening to almost everything under the sun, I have finally (well kinda) decided on my HT set up.
B&W 802D
B&W HTM2D
B&W DS8S
B&W ASW855
Classe CA3200 (Upgrade from Rotel RMB1095)
Classe CA2200
Meridian G98
Meridian G68
So, all done and ready to roll, wife approved so off to the dealer I went. And then the Meridian dealer says "well, you should get the Meridian speakers as they sound better than the 802s and I think the 802s are overpriced for what they are, plus Meridian is the granddaddy of digital speakers, plus all the built in amplification and blah, balh (tuned out after that)" to which I replied that I really liked the natural, clean sound of the B&W. Of course, when I listened to them they were playing through all Classe electronics, including the pre/pro and the DVD/CD player. So, my question is, has anyone has any experience with the Meridian gear? I have only heard them through Meridian speakers and they sound quite good, but to me a bit clinical. I do however like the feature set on the pre pro and that they are at the forefront of the new lossless formats being used for Dolby HD, but I still prefer the sound of the 802D, to me a lot more presence and forward sound, and tweeters that you do not hear.
